Job description
Under direct supervision and guidance of the Director General of National Programs and Projects Monitoring, the M & E Officer in charge of Economic Cluster will be responsible of the following:
1. Monitor progress on the implementation of projects, Policies and Programs under economic sectors.
• Monitor the implementation of projects/Policies/Programs and submit regular implementation performance reports (including
• undertaking regular field visits);
• Participate in projects/Policies/Programs reviews within the sector and prepare reports on review findings;
• Produce analytical reports on projects/Policies/Program budget proposals submitted by assigned institutions to facilitate
• effective budget formulation;
• Advise management on strategic interventions for improving projects/Policies/Programs performance within the assigned
• Sectors and Districts;
• Work with line institutions to improve mechanisms for Projects/Policies/Programs delivery;
• Work with focal points in assigned institutions in the preparation of quarterly reports on Projects/Policies/Programs
• performance;
• Identify implementation bottlenecks and recommend appropriate measures to enhance Projects/Policies/Programs delivery in
• sectors of responsibility;
• Monitor the implementation of recommended actions to improve Projects/Policies/Programs performance;
